Easy to use pretty tight maybe this will get easier as I work out more. I can only do a few reps at a time then must rest. I walk 10k plus a day, but these are different muscles. Fatigue hits pretty quickly. Easy to put together. Easy to use, small and compact. You can change the tension a little by moving the product up/down your leg. Small and easy to store. Comes with a little book of suggested exercises and amount of reps to use. I chose the green, and it’s nice. Numerous low key colors if you’re not interested in all black equipment.
